17th Annual SBAWS Walk-N-Roll is a running race on August 8, 2026 in Puyallup, WA.
From the Organizer
Join us on Saturday, August 8th, as we will be hosting our 17th annual Spina Bifida Walk-N-Roll fundraiser! This is a paved 1-mile flat path around Bradley Lake Park in Puyallup, great for both walking and rolling. It’s free to sign up and participate, but we HIGHLY encourage participants over age 18+ to donate or fundraise at least $25 or more. All funds raised will be used for local WA State Spina Bifida events such as our Spring Fling, Adult Meetups, Walk-N-Roll events, and our holiday party, as well as funding grants, resources, and more!
Please make sure to register online here, or you can register on the day of the event starting at 10am, but the earlier you register the longer you have to gather donations. You can sign up as an individual, as a team, or you can join a team. We recommend creating a team if you have more than two people walking, since you can always add more people to your team! You can easily sign up multiple people at a time as well!
We look forward to seeing you on August 8th! Wear matching shirts, costumes, or a certain color. We encourage you to find a way to make it fun.
